Casey's disclaims any intention or obligation to update or revise forward-looking statements, whether as a result of new information, future events or otherwise.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">We will take a few minutes to summarize the quarter, and then open it up for questions.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">As most of you have seen, diluted earnings per share in the third quarter were $1.01 compared to $0.33 a year ago. Year-to-date diluted earnings per share were $3.57 compared to $2.73. The record third-quarter earnings is a result of strong fuel margin environment that most all fuel retailers experienced, and strong sales growth throughout our Business.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">EBITDA in the third quarter was up 81% compared to a year ago. Year-to-date EBITDA was up 25.5%.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Before we go into each category to give more detail on what is driving our results, I'll remind everyone that we will release our February same-store sales results on Thursday, March 12.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">During the third quarter, we experienced a declining wholesale fuel cost environment that contributed to a record fuel margin of $0.22 per gallon compared to $0.136 per gallon in the same period a year ago. The third-quarter margin also benefited from a $5-million increase in renewable fuel credits, commonly known as RENs, compared to the same period last year. During the quarter, we sold 14 million RENs for $8.4 million. This represented a $0.019 favorable impact to the fuel margin.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Currently, RENs are trading around $0.70. Last year in the fourth quarter, the average RENs sold were $0.47. Year to date, the fuel margin is $0.201 per gallon; well ahead of our annual goal.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Lower retail fuel prices and favorable weather comparisons from last year drove same-store gallons up 2.2% during the quarter. Total gallons sold in the quarter increased 8.6% to 446.8 million. The average retail price of fuel for the quarter was $2.36 a gallon, compared to $3.05 last year. Fuel gross profit for the quarter was up 76% to $98.4 million. Same-store gallons sold year to date were up 2.5%, with total gallons sold for the year up nearly 9% to 1.4 billion.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">In the grocery and other merchandise category, same-store sales were above our annual goal, increasing 7.7% in the quarter. Total sales during this period rose 13.1% to $412.7 million. We experienced double-digit sales growth in nearly every area of this category, including cigarettes. We were especially pleased with the growth in packaged beverages, as we expand the number of stores with increased cooler capacity throughout our store base.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Overall, we are pleased with the gains in this category. For the quarter, gross profit dollars rose 13.4% to $128.6 million. And year-to-date same-store sales were up 7.3%, with an average margin of 32%.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Prepared food and fountain category continued its strong performance. Total sales were up 20.3% to $190.4 million for the quarter.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Same-store sales in the quarter were up 14.1%, with an average margin of 58.7%, down 210 basis points from the same period a year ago. The margin was down primarily due to an increase in stales, and higher supply costs on certain items, offset by slightly lower cheese costs. The average cost of cheese this quarter was $2.05 per pound, compared to $2.17 a year ago. The Company recently took advantage of declining cheese costs, and locked in our cost of cheese at $1.89 per pound through December of 2015.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Even though the margin was down in the quarter, we were able to increase gross profit dollars 16.1% to $111.7 million. Year-to-date same-store sales were up 12%, with an average margin of 59.3%. The increase in sales in both the quarter and year to date were driven by an increase in the number of stores, and a continued benefit of our operational initiatives mentioned in the press release.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">At the nine-month mark, operating expenses were up 12.5%. For the quarter, operating expenses increased 11.2% to $238.8 million. The majority of this increase was due to a rise in wages, primarily related to operating 86 more stores this quarter compared to the same period a year ago, and an increase in the rollout of the operational initiatives described in the press release.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">On the income statement, total revenue in the quarter was down 6.6% to $1.7 billion. This is due to a 22.5% decrease in the retail price of fuel, offset by an increase in the number of stores in operation this quarter compared to the same period a year ago, and the addition of more stores with one or more of our operational initiatives. Year to date, total revenue was up 3.3%, primarily due to sales increases in the categories mentioned previously, offset, again, by a lower retail fuel price.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">The effective tax rate in the quarter was up 210 basis points, primarily due to higher book income from a year ago in the same period, without similar increases in permanent tax differences.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Our balance sheet continues to be strong. As of January 31, cash and cash equivalents were $43.6 million. Long-term debt, net of current maturities, was $845.8 million, while shareholder equity rose to $839.1 million, up $135.8 million from the fiscal year end. We generated $239.9 million in cash flow from operations.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">At the nine-month mark, capital expenditures were $329.2 million, compared to $269.1 million a year ago in the same period. At the beginning of the year, our capital expenditure projection was between $360 million and $410 million, and we expect the year to finish in that range.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">This quarter, we opened 12 new store constructions, and completed three acquisitions. For the year, we have acquired 32 stores, and completed 33 new store constructions. We are on pace to complete a total of 40 to 45 new store constructions by the end of the fiscal year. Year to date, we have replaced 25 stores. We currently have 26 new stores under construction, and 11 replacement stores under construction.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">In addition to this, we have an additional 40 new sites under contract. Our store count at the end of the fiscal quarter was 1,869 corporate stores.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">In addition to the unit growth, year to date we have converted 110 more locations to a 24-hour format, added 12 additional stores to the pizza delivery program, and completed 17 major remodels. The combination of these initiatives accounts for approximately 35% of the same-store sales increase, as reported previously.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Lastly, the second distribution center in Terre Haute, Indiana, is on schedule, with an opening date in early calendar-year 2016. The estimated full build-out cost will be $50 million.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">This completes our review of the quarter. Just looking at the prepared food margins, you mentioned that there was a higher stales in the quarter. Just wondering what was going on there?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Great question. I'm glad you asked the question. And so for us, Irene, our business, we always manage to gross profit dollars.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">So we don't get too worked up on a same-store sales movement or a margin movement as long as the gross profit dollars are coming in where we think it should come in. And so what you're seeing in this quarter and probably even in the last several quarters is we're certainly placing a greater focus on making sure we have the right products out in the warmers at the right time of the day to match the consumer demand.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">So that's part of the reason why you saw sales up over 20% in the third quarter. That's the highest it's been in the last three years. And then gross profit, obviously, up over 16%, again, one of the highest levels we've had in the last two to three years.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">And so to specifically answer your question on the 210-basis-point drop, you look at stales, obviously, when you're doing that you're going to throw some product away because our products, since they are made fresh, have a shelf life of roughly about an hour in the warmer. So you are going to discard product to meet that demand, and so that's what we are seeing.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">The majority of that 210-basis-point drop was due to an increase in stales. We did have some increases year-over-year with respect to some of the toppings of pizza, primarily the meat. Coffee was up about 46% Q3 over Q3, however, that has now since subsequently come down and we should be seeing a tailwind in the coffee here for the next several quarters.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">We also had some supply cost increases. The biggest supply cost was in our cups. We switched over to a new cup, one that was a little more expensive. And so you roll all of that up and that would be the answer to the 210-basis-point drop.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">The other thing I want to point out is, I mentioned the cheese cost was $2.05 relative to $2.17, and so I think there might have been an indication, or maybe an assumption that the cheese cost would be a much greater differential. We did have very high cheese costs early in the third quarter, and the cheese costs did not come down until the tail end of the quarter. You should start to see some of that benefit as we locked in at $1.89.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">I'll remind everyone last year in the fourth quarter our average cheese cost was $2.58. So definitely we are going to see a tailwind in the third quarter with respect to that, as well as the coffee.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">The last thing on the margin with respect to cheese costs would be, there is a tail factor with respect to the cost of cheese. So when the cheese cost comes down or goes up, you typically won't see that probably for three or four weeks that product getting onto a pizza into the store due to inventory we have at the store and in the warehouse. Hopefully, that explains the downward movement in the margin.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Irene Nattel </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- RBC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Absolutely. That's very helpful. And can you just please remind us, Bill, what the EPS sensitivity is on the cheese costs?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Well, I can tell you what the margin is. Every $0.10 per pound swing is about 35 to 40 basis points to the overall prepared food margin.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Irene Nattel </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- RBC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;So, clearly, very strong tailwind in Q4? But just coming back to the higher stales, as you look at -- as you do your analysis of which parts of the day or which products you're seeing the highest stales, do you think that's something that you can sort of grind down a little bit as you go through the next few quarters, or is that something that we should expect to be sort of a phenomenon going forward?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Well, we did create a new position, roughly starting this year, a food service manager position that places more focus in the prepared food area. So, again, their task is to optimize the prepared food category, and for us optimizing means gross profit dollars.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">So we are always cognizant of the stale factor because we're certainly cognizant that it does impact the margin, but to say whether that will come down or not might be a little more difficult at this point. But it's something that we are very focused on, obviously, evident by creating the position that focuses on that area.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Irene Nattel </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- RBC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;That's very helpful. As, with the gas prices meaningfully lower, how are you seeing that play out inside the store, just in terms of consumer purchasing patterns?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Yes, definitely, we have seen over the last quarter to two quarters a shift to more premium brand of cigarettes. We believe it's a function of more discretionary income in our consumer's pocket, in a sense, maybe trading up into a premium brand. Most of those brands are typically a little bit lower margin, but a higher penny profit, so that's also coming into part of the reason why you see the flattish margin in grocery and general merchandise.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">We have seen, obviously, in the last probably quarter to two quarters a nice uptick in same-store customer count. It's a function of several things, one of the primary function would be the lower retail fuel price driving customers, but also back in late January and February we did see a very high Powerball jackpot. You might recall that.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Any time we see that type of environment we do see an increased foot traffic in our stores. But definitely the lower retail fuel price is helping customer traffic.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Irene Nattel </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- RBC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;That's great. That's helpful. And then, I guess, just on pizza delivery, how do you feel about the potential for that -- for more stores, is it just a more refined analysis on where that can go? Or is that kind of reaching capacity in where that makes sense to add it to the existing store base?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;No. It has not reached capacity by any stretch. To give you a little bit of thought process on the pizza delivery area, right now we have roughly about 330 to 340 or so stores that are delivering pizza. We've only added 12 this fiscal year, and right now that will be the only ones that we will add for the remaining part of this fiscal year.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">Coming into the fiscal year, the thought process was about 80 or so stores to add pizza delivery. We are actually deferring those until the beginning, or shortly after the beginning of the next fiscal year.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">The reason for that is we are in the process of rolling out online ordering. We have that now in stores here in the metro area, the Des Moines metro area.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">We like what we see, if we continue to like what we see, we plan on expanding that next fiscal year. So we'd like to get that up and operational before we start rolling out the pizza delivery anymore. However, to answer your question, we think there's tremendous opportunity in pizza delivery, so you will see more stores coming online next fiscal year.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Kelly Bania </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- BMO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Great. And in terms of online ordering, is the app now available, or is that just Web-based at this point?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;It would be both. Just in the stores that I mentioned here in the Des Moines metro area, so when we roll this out to the remaining parts of our store base, it will be an app, as well as a Web-based.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Kelly Bania </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- BMO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Got it. And then, if I could just ask one more about the cooler capacity, how many stores now have that expanded cooler capacity? And how many more over time could accommodate that?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Yes, so when we talk about cooler capacity, we're talking about any store that we actually touch from a construction standpoint, so all new stores, all replacements, and major remodels will get the expanded cooler capacity. So when you take a step back and look at that, we have about 235 major remodels that we have completed, and so all of those would have the expanded cooler capacity.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">And then the new stores, over the last three to four fiscal years, would have that. So you roll that up, we're only talking probably in about the 500 to 600 locations that have the expanded cooler capacity.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">So we will continue to get greater penetration, especially when you start looking at the potential of accelerating any type of major remodels. That's one of the areas that we're looking at. The major remodels now are our double-digit ROI and certainly looking to enhance that program.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Kelly Bania </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- BMO Capital Markets -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Great. It's our observation that it looks like there is a quick move upward on any negative news in fuel and how that's affecting the dynamics of the fuel margin in your business?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Well, certainly, we've had a nice run over the last three to four months with the wholesale costs declining, and, obviously, it has benefited our fuel margin because the retailers in our market area were certainly slow to respond to that and, obviously, expanded the margin. I would say here recently, and you probably alluded to that, is that we have seen an uptick in the wholesale fuel cost of fuel and we have recently seen a corresponding movement in the retail prices.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">So now to sustain a $0.20-plus gas margin, if wholesale costs continue to rise, that might be a little more challenging. So we'll have a little more information on the fuel margin for February here in a few days.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Chuck Cerankosky </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Northcoast Research -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;All right. Going back to the stales challenge with the increased number of products and depth in the warmers, do you have the data to watch by store and day part to determine how much is too much and where you should be increasing?</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Bill Walljasper </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Casey's General Stores Inc - CFO </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;Absolutely, yes. We have the ability to drill down on an hour-by-hour, realtime basis if we choose to. So we definitely have the data, and we have production planners, they get tweaked on a very regular basis on a store-by-store basis to match the consumer demand in that particular location, so we are very cognizant.</font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">And I will say this too, the increased stale factor we do not see has a negative. We see that as a positive. We are giving the product out in the warmers and selling that product, and, again, the focus is on gross profit dollars.</font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:120%;"><hr></div><div style="line-height:105%;padding-bottom:5px;padding-top:5px;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-weight:bold;">&#32;Chuck Cerankosky </font><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;font-style:italic;font-weight:bold;">&#32;- Northcoast Research - Analyst </font></div><div style="line-height:120%;text-align:left;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;"><br></font></div><div style="line-height:110%;padding-bottom:13px;text-align:justify;font-size:8pt;"><font style="font-family:inherit;font-size:8pt;">&#32;All right.
